引言:区块链和加密的基本概念

在讨论多重解密之前,了解区块链和加密的基本概念是非常重要的。区块链是一种去中心化的数据库技术,其数据结构被称为“区块”,这些区块按时间顺序相连,从而形成链条。而加密则是保护数据的一种手段,通过将原始数据转化为不可读的形式,确保信息的安全。

在区块链中,数据的安全性往往依赖于加密技术。常见的加密算法如SHA-256广泛用于比特币等加密货币。这些技术确保了数据不被未授权用户访问及篡改,但在某些情况下,我们也需要考虑当数据被加密后如何实现解密,尤其是在涉及用户隐私时。

什么是多重解密?

多重解密的定义可以简单理解为在加密数据的情况下,使用多个密钥或多种方式恢复出原始数据。这种技术能有效防止单点故障,确保即使某个密钥被暴露,数据依然是可靠的。在实践中,这意味着可以使用不同的方式来解密同一份数据,增加了安全性。

比如说,在某个企业中,多重解密可以让特定团队使用不同的访问权限访问敏感数据。这样,一方面保护了数据的完整性,另一方面也确保了数据访问的透明度。

多重解密的实际应用场景

在区块链技术中,多重解密可以广泛应用于智能合约、数字身份验证等场景。例如在智能合约中,多个参与者可能需要对合约内容进行解密,而每个参与者根据自己的权限可能只需要访问合约中的某一部分信息。

此外,在数字身份验证中,用户的身份信息往往需要多重解密。例如,某位用户可能需要输入多种身份验证信息,包括生物识别信息、密码等。这样即使其中一种信息被破解,用户的数据仍然会得到保护。

实施多重解密时的挑战

虽然多重解密为用户提供了更高的安全性,但在实施过程中我们也会面临一些挑战。首当其冲的是资源消耗问题。使用多种解密机制往往需要消耗更多的计算资源和网络带宽。

另外,如何管理不同的密钥也是一个重要的挑战。每种密钥会带来不同的管理成本和复杂性,尤其是在大型组织中,确保每个用户都能安全且顺利地使用这些密钥是亟需解决的问题。

选择合适的加密算法

选择合适的加密算法是实施多重解密的基础。当前有多种加密算法可供选择,如对称加密和非对称加密。对称加密算法如AES适合数据量较小且性能要求较高的场景,而非对称加密例如RSA则更适合需要确保数据传输安全的场合。

在选择时,不仅要考虑安全性,还要考虑到算法的效率和实施难度。复杂的算法可能会增加开发和维护成本,因此合适的平衡非常关键。

常见误区:多重解密是万无一失的吗?

多重解密并不是万无一失的。许多人认为,只要实现了多重解密,数据就一定安全,但实际上,如果密钥管理不当,或是解密过程中的某个环节被攻击者利用,依然可能导致数据泄露。

此外,过于复杂的解密流程可能导致用户在实际操作中的错误,使得安全性反而下降。因此,在设计多重解密机制时,简练、安全和易用性都必须考虑进去。

用户体验与安全性的权衡

在增加多重解密层级的同时,用户体验很可能受到影响。比如,用户可能需要输入多个密钥或进行多重身份验证,这会使得操作变得繁琐。因此,如何在用户体验和安全性之间找到平衡是一项重要的设计任务。

对于一些普通用户而言,繁杂的解密过程可能会导致他们不愿意使用相关技术。这就要求开发者在设计时,能找到简化流程的方案,让用户在获取高安全性的同时,保持良好的使用体验。

未来的多重解密发展趋势

随着区块链技术和加密算法的不断发展,多重解密的应用场景和技术手段也在逐步演进。未来,更多的创新性技术,如量子计算,可能会应用于加密和解密的过程中,这将催生新的机遇与挑战。

同时,用户对数据隐私保护的重视也在不断提升,这为多重解密的广泛应用提供了契机。市场需求的增长将促使更多的企业探索多重解密的实施方案,提升数据安全性的同时也兼顾用户体验。

个人经验分享:实施多重解密的挑战

在我参与的一个区块链项目中,我们曾尝试实施多重解密功能。起初,我以为这会是一个简单的技术实现,但后来发现挑战不小。例如团队对加密算法的理解就存在差异,有些成员对非对称加密并不熟悉,导致初期的设计方案并不完善。

通过几轮讨论和实践,我们最终选择了一种符合团队整体技术水平的加密算法。同时,我们制定了详细的密钥管理方案,确保每个人都能在安全的情况下访问所需资料。这一过程让我体会到,在多重解密的实施中,团队的沟通与协作是极其重要的。

实践中的技术细节和注意事项

在实施过程中,我们特别注意到密钥的生成和存储,需要采用高安全性的方式。一些开发者可能会选择简单的存储方式,但这往往会面临较大的安全风险。例如,存储在云端的密钥如果遭受黑客的攻击,将会导致所有数据一并被暴露。

我们最终选择了硬件安全模块(HSM)作为密钥管理的解决方案,以确保密钥的安全存储。同时,也制定了一系列高强度的访问控制策略,只有通过多重身份验证的用户才能访问相关信息,增加了数据泄露的难度。

总结与展望

多重解密是一项具有现实意义的技术选择,能够在增强数据安全性的同时,确保用户隐私受到保护。然而,在实施过程中我们仍需面对资源消耗、密钥管理等一系列挑战。对于每个希望使用这一技术的团队而言,了解并解决这些问题,将是未来技术成功实现的关键。

展望未来,随着各类新技术的不断出现,多重解密将会迎来新的发展机遇。希望每个对这一领域感兴趣的人都能积极探索,为更安全的区块链技术贡献自己的力量。

(以上内容仅供参考,如需要进一步扩展或详细讨论特定领域,请注明具体需求。)